Angry Night
-
News
Angry Night Protests in Aden
Angry protests erupted in the southern Yemeni port city of Aden on Thursday over worsening electricity services as temperatures soared…
Read More »
Angry protests erupted in the southern Yemeni port city of Aden on Thursday over worsening electricity services as temperatures soared…
Read More »